The Real Wealth Builders

People often assume wealthy individuals have access to secret strategies. In many cases, they simply follow basic principles for long periods. They spend less than they earn. They invest consistently. They avoid unnecessary debt. They give compound growth enough time to do its job. Yet those small actions frequently produce stronger outcomes than dramatic financial moves. Simple systems also reduce emotional decisions. When money management becomes routine, there is less temptation to react to every headline or market swing.

Patience Is the Hidden Advantage

The wealth secret that rarely gets attention is patience. Most people underestimate how powerful a decade can be. They focus on what can happen in a month and ignore what can happen in ten years. Money tends to reward people who stay committed to a sensible plan. It rewards persistence more than prediction. You do not need perfect timing. You need enough discipline to keep showing up. That may not sound exciting enough for a viral video. It probably never will. But if your goal is long-term financial growth rather than internet fame, boring can be surprisingly profitable.
